Tracking granularity levels for accessing a spatial index

    Abstract: A database engine may track granularity levels for accessing a spatial index. Granularity levels of a spatial index may be evaluated to identify those granularity levels that identify data objects in a data set. An indication of the identified granularity levels may be stored as part of metadata for the data set. When a spatial query directed to the data set is received, the spatial index may be accessed at the identified granularity levels indicated in the metadata for the data set as part of processing the spatial query.

    Selective maintenance of a spatial index

    Abstract: A storage engine may selectively maintain a spatial index for accessing spatial data. A spatial query may be received and the portions of the spatial index to evaluate may be determined by replacing those portions associated with regions identified for the query that do not exist in the spatial index with portions that do exist in the spatial index and are associated with a region that includes the identified regions. When inserting spatial objects into the spatial index, a determination may be made whether to create a new portion in the index if none currently exist that match a spatial index value for a new spatial object or to modify the spatial index value of the spatial object to insert the spatial object into an existing portion of the spatial index.
